Grace Appearing is a gorgeous 3 bedroom, 3.5 bathroom home located on the opulent ocean side of Emerald Isle. The spectacular location is just a short 3-min. walk to the beach! It is the ideal getaway for your whole group to spend a week away!

This striking home comes with the added convenience of a GOURMET kitchen that includes high-end appliances, a gas range, and reverse osmosis water filtration system.

This is the ideal family-friendly getaway (yes, babies too!). The home has tons of convenient features to make traveling with babies simple peasy like a pack-n-play, high chair, and infant gates!

You will never run out of things to do with all of the entertainment features at your disposal. The game room features a ping pong table and foosball table for a fun evening indoors.You can also savor a game of volleyball in the private pool with the supplied net!

Linens includes 1 king, 2 queens, 2 twins, and 1 double/twin bunk, and 1 twin daybed. A pack and play will also included - if you need sheets for the pack and play, you will need to provide your own.

Linens and towels supplied with beds made (weekly stays only).

Rents weekly from Saturday to Saturday.

Nightly units allowed with a 2-nighttime minimum stay (off-season only).

No smoking. Family Animals Stay Free. (2 Dogs Max)

Please Note: Pool will be closed November through February.

Please Note: Management Company reserves the right to deny stays less than 7 nights, if the arrival date is more than 30 days out from the booking date. Stays less than 7 nights, with an arrival date between mid-April to mid-October, are stringently prohibited unless approved by management.

How to get the best value:

  • In the New Bern area, The earlier you can reserve a home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ental properties are reserved early. Booking your rental up to 12 months before your vacation is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to search for and book your rental home.
  • To find the best value, try shifting your family's New Bern vacation to the Spring or Fall seasons. May, September, and October offer excellent temperatures, fewer crowds, and re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the Summer months.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a New Bern v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Owners sometimes offer discounts for veterans. Make sure to check with your property manager to see if special offers are available for your family before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ners typically offer customers an option to obtain tr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for specifics.
  • Look for your local New Bern area magazine upon arrival. If your rental home do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local stories, visitor guides have discounts for local accommodations and attractions.

Know before you go:

  • Get the property manager's contact number and check in/check out procedures for your rental home. Store the host's contact information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Property managers are there to help! Don't be shy to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Protect the property owner (and your things!) by locking the rental when you are away, just like you would back home.
  • To make certain damages aren't linked to your visit, inspect the rental for any problem areas upon check in. Call the host immediately to relay any issues. If there is a dispute, having the recorded issues and contact attempts will be valuable.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You'll enhance your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ors can be an incredible resource to find the best local attractions.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Locals can frequently point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to order delicious takeout,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Re-check the vacation property to confirm that you've packed all of your family's items at check-out. Remember to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den treasure.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property a final time and look for any damage. We suggest in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the host is not available, take video of the rental to record its condition.
  • After your trip, leave feedback! Property managers rely on great feedback to stimulate more reservations. They'll be thankful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something went awry, other vacationing families will appreciate that you share your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Please be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to remedy it.
